About Elk Run Heights, IA

Elk Run Heights is a small community in Iowa with a population of 968 residents. The median household income is $68,828 per year, which is near the national average. The median age in Elk Run Heights is 56.6 years.

Housing in Elk Run Heights has a median home value of $169,400 and median monthly rent of $1,250. Of the 463 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 407 owner-occupied and 32 renter-occupied units.

The unemployment rate in Elk Run Heights is 1.0% and the poverty rate is 2.6%. 15.6%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 21.6 minutes.

Cost of Living in Elk Run Heights, IA

Compared to national averages, Elk Run Heights has a median household income of $68,828 (8% below the national median of $75,149). Home values average $169,400, which is 31% below the national median. Monthly rent at $1,250 is 7% above the US average of $1,163. Within Iowa, Elk Run Heights's income is 1% above the state average of $67,947, and home values are 28% above the state median of $132,237.
